I have a camera responsible for updating some texture by rendering to it.
What is the preferred way/callback to let the camera run only every
10th frame or so.
I know I can use the the nodevisitor to get the framenumber, but I'm
puzzled which callback to use to skip the camera all

I struggled with the same problem. The way how I resolved this was by
keeping reference to the camera and working with the NodeMask (the camera
was turned on at each N-th frame, otherwise was off). And the framebuffer
was kept this way

You could use an osg::Sequence node above the RTT osg::Camera that makes
sure it's only traversed are certainly times, or use a custom cull callack
attached to an osg::Group that decorates your RTT osg::Camera and decides
whether to traverse or not to the interval you want.
